U.S. Air Force Maj. Kyle Hooper, a 2013 Virginia Tech Corps of Cadets alumnus who earned his degree in business from the Pamplin College of Business, was selected as the Hokie Hero for Saturday’s football game against Old Dominion University.

The Hokie Hero program honors corps alumni who are deployed. Recipients are highlighted by Bill Roth and Mike Burnop during their radio broadcast of Hokie football games, on the Corps of Cadets website, and in the Corps Review alumni magazine. 

Hooper is the director for operations with the 386th Expeditionary Aircraft Maintenance Squadron in Kuwait, where he has been deployed since May. During his time in the corps, he was a member of Kilo Company and served as the 3rd Battalion executive officer his senior year.
